Cyclical rather than seasonal, I think, though the weather may play some role.

> is it the war?

It's people cross-posting randomly about the war.

>Is there anything to do

Use your killfile liberally, respond to off-topic posters via email and ask them to stop, and report them when appropriate (which is rarely) to their ISPs.

>Are any of these people actually trying to recruit

Impossible to know.

>Does taking the piss out of these

No. It makes the situation worse. While people who unintentionally cross-post or post off topic can be shown the error of their ways with civility, genuine trolls can't be helped by any means. Responding to trolls in kind with negative reinforcement gives them exactly what they come here for. Killfile or ignore them.

>Is moderating an answer?
